Located north of Lake Griffin, the Australian War Memorial is a green-grey dome built to commemorate Australian soldiers killed in World War II. It was built in 1941, opened in 1945 and completed in 1971. It covers an area of 13,000 square meters and is surrounded by 12 hectares of lawn.
